[关闭]
@Wahson 2019-03-20T21:10:43.000000Z 字数 743 阅读 626

订单开发目标

Wanbo


第一期:

新建销售订单:

  1. 1. 新建销售订单
  2. 2. 新建销售子单
  3. 3. 新建采购订单,多个商品时需要根据供应商进行拆单
  4. 4. 新建采购子单
  5. 5. 销售子单绑定采购子单

添加物流信息:

  1. 1. 新建物流单(主单、子单)

录入销售合同:

  1. 1. 新建采购合同

录入采购合同:

  1. 1. 新建采购合同
  2. 2. 更新对应销售子单状态为采购已确认

提交审批:

  1. 1. 更新销售订单为待审核

订单审核:

  1. 1. 审核销售合同
  2. 2. 审核采购合同

取消订单:

  1. 1. 取消销售子单
  2. 2. 取消销售单
  3. 3. 取消采购子单
  4. 4. 取消采购单

订单收款

  1. 1. 流水关联销售订单
  2. 2. 主单.status = if(子单.forall(已收款)) 部分收款 else 已收款
  3. 3. if(子单.forall(已发货))

订单签收

  1. 1. 更新销售单状态为已签收

任务时间计划: 清明节前完成

问题:
1. 收款和发货是两个独立流程,部分收款和已收款两个状态通过收款流程计算得到,已发货通过物流流程计算得到,订单状态分别有2个流程确定,但状态只有一个,那么当
部分收款,未发货
部分收款,已发货
已收款,未发货
已收款,已发货
订单应取哪个状态?

待办:
修改销售订单
新建销售子单
采购单流程
登录模块
权限控制

添加新批注
在作者公开此批注前,只有你和作者可见。
回复批注